GROOMS v. HARVEY

No. 82-181.

418 So.2d 467 (1982)

Margaret Rose GROOMS, Appellant, v. Margaret D. HARVEY,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Second District.

August 27, 1982.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Richard H. Bailey of Harllee, Porges, Bailey & Durkin, Bradenton, for appellant.

Douglas A. Wallace, Bradenton, for appellee.


OTT, Chief Judge.

This is an appeal from a judgment for custody on writ of habeas corpus which ordered surrender of Sherrie Ann Grooms, a minor child of 12 years, by the appellant to appellee. The issue of the best interests and ultimate welfare of the child was never fairly presented or tried. We therefore hold that a new trial on custody is required.
